Exodus
Exodus is a book of deliverance. The book begins with the story of the Israelites in bondage and the birth of a deliverer, Moses, who escapes death as an infant. God delivers the Israelites from Egyptian slavery through the baptism of the Red Sea. In chapter 15, we find a song of deliverance sung by Moses and the children of Israel. God gave the law to allow the people to live in freedom and celebrations to remember their deliverance.

The Bible is a compilation of 66 books. Each book has an overarching theme. Multiple stories and texts in each book point to an attribute of God. When these themes are recognized, they help us understand the message of that book better. It also allows us to see how One Single Story is woven from beginning to end. Ultimately, each theme will enable us to understand Jesus and why He came.
